Market Size
The global market for homomorphic encryption was valued at USD 272.52 million in 2023. With an expected CAGR of 9.6% from 2024 to 2030, the market is projected to reach USD 517.69 million by the end of the forecast period. This growth is fueled by the increasing demand for secure data transmission and storage, particularly in the finance and healthcare sectors.

Overview
Homomorphic encryption allows for computations on encrypted data without decrypting it, thus preserving data privacy. This technology is gaining traction in various sectors due to the rising concerns over data security. The market is witnessing robust growth driven by advancements in secure cloud computing and secure data sharing technologies.

Regional Analysis
The Homomorphic Encryption Market is segmented into five key regions: North America, Europe, Asia-Pacific, the Middle East & Africa, and South America. North America holds the largest market share due to the early adoption of encryption technologies by major tech companies. Europe follows closely, with significant contributions from the UK and France. The Asia-Pacific region is expected to witness the fastest growth, driven by increasing investments in data security infrastructure in countries like India and South Korea.

COVID-19 Impact Analysis
The COVID-19 pandemic has accelerated the adoption of homomorphic encryption as organizations moved to remote work environments, increasing the demand for secure data transmission. This shift has highlighted the importance of advanced encryption methods in protecting sensitive information from cyber threats.
